George Patrick Duffy, 94, of Pawtucket died on May 23, 2015. He was the husband of Helen F. (Richards) Duffy. They were married 71 years.

Mr. Duffy was born in Pawtucket, the son of the late Frederick Duffy and Emma (Locklin) Duffy. He was a United States Coast Guard Veteran of WWII where he served on the U.S.S. Menges which was torpedoed by a German U-Boat in the Mediterranean Sea.

George had a long and storied career in athletics and entertainment throughout New England. He is principally recognized as the longtime voice of the Rhode Island Reds of the American Hockey League where he was the publicist and broadcaster. He was also a coach in the Pawtucket Little League, where he led their all-star team to the 1980 Little League World Series. He also served as Commissioner of the Pawtucket Boys and Girls Club’s Baseball Program and volunteered for the Club in a variety of capacities for many years.

Mr. Duffy was a member of the Boys and Girls Club of Pawtucket’s Hall of Fame as well as a member of the City of Pawtucket’s Hall of Fame.
